Automatic product conceptual optimization based on object-oriented performance components and graph grammars

Compared with parameter uncertainty, model form uncertainty is difficult and expensive to alleviate due to limited design information at the early product development stage, but it may have significant impacts on performances of complex products. In this article, an optimal configuration of performance models based on graph grammars is presented to seek a solution for simultaneously resolving model form and parameter uncertainties at the product conceptual design stage. First, a hybrid performance component database is built using object-oriented modeling method taking account of the model evolution history; second, a function structure model is taken as the reference template to dynamically generate system models driven by graph grammars rules derived from product configuration and layout design and matching of component interface parameters with flows in the function structure model; third, a meta-model-based method is adopted to transform the performance component graph into mathematical models including the optimization objective function and associated constraints; fourth, an optimization procedure combined with performance simulation framework is invoked to solve the optimization problem. The final result is a solution that includes the optimal configuration of performance components and optimal design parameters, and thus, much larger design space than traditional mere optimization of design variables is explored. The method is tested by the optimal conceptual design of tank movement systems, and comparisons of deign results obtained by the proposed method and traditional optimization method are conducted to illustrate the efficacy of the method.

[1]  Dimitri N. Mavris,et al.  Robust Design Simulation: A Probabilistic Approach to Multidisciplinary Design , 1999 .

[2]  Ilan Kroo,et al.  Aircraft design using collaborative optimization , 1996 .

[3]  A. M. Hasofer,et al.  Exact and Invariant Second-Moment Code Format , 1974 .

[4]  John E. Renaud,et al.  Worst case propagated uncertainty of multidisciplinary systems in robust design optimization , 2000 .

[5]  G. A. Gabriele,et al.  Improved coordination in nonhierarchic system optimization , 1993 .

[6]  Michel van Tooren,et al.  Review of uncertainty-based multidisciplinary design optimization methods for aerospace vehicles , 2011 .

[7]  Jay D. Martin,et al.  A Methodology to Manage System-level Uncertainty During Conceptual Design , 2006 .

[8]  J. Won,et al.  7th World Congresses of Structural and Multidisciplinary Optimization , 2005 .

[9]  Barry Boehm,et al.  Spiral Development: Experience, Principles, and Refinements , 2000 .

[10]  Kyung K. Choi,et al.  Hybrid Analysis Method for Reliability-Based Design Optimization , 2003 .

[11]  Jonathan Cagan,et al.  GGREADA: A graph grammar-based machine design algorithm , 1997 .

[12]  Jacobus E. Rooda,et al.  A Nonhierarchical Formulation of Analytical Target Cascading , 2010 .

[13]  R. Rackwitz,et al.  Structural reliability under combined random load sequences , 1978 .

[14]  Wei Chen,et al.  Collaborative Reliability Analysis under the Framework of Multidisciplinary Systems Design , 2005 .

[15]  Simon Szykman,et al.  A functional basis for engineering design: Reconciling and evolving previous efforts , 2002 .

[16]  Deyi Xue,et al.  A concurrent engineering-oriented design database representation model , 2004, Comput. Aided Des..

[17]  Rainer Leupers,et al.  Multiprocessor Systems on Chip: Design Space Exploration , 2011 .

[18]  Wei Chen,et al.  A Hierarchical Statistical Sensitivity Analysis Method for Complex Engineering Systems Design , 2007, DAC 2007.

[19]  Jian Su,et al.  Automatic Differentiation in Robust Optimization , 1997 .

[20]  Wei Zhao,et al.  A strategy for resolving evolutionary performance coupling at the early stages of complex engineering design , 2011 .

[21]  Sean P. Kenny,et al.  Needs and Opportunities for Uncertainty- Based Multidisciplinary Design Methods for Aerospace Vehicles , 2002 .

[22]  K. Shea,et al.  Automatically Transforming Object-Oriented Graph-Based Representations Into Boolean Satisfiability Problems for Computational Design Synthesis , 2013 .

[23]  Harish Agarwal,et al.  Reliability Based Design Optimization: Formulations and Methodologies , 2004 .

[24]  Wei Dong,et al.  A Hybrid Model for Optimal Concurrent Design of Solid Oxide Fuel Cell System Considering Functional Performance and Production Cost , 2008, Concurr. Eng. Res. Appl..

[25]  Kathryn B. Laskey Model uncertainty: theory and practical implications , 1996, IEEE Trans. Syst. Man Cybern. Part A.

[26]  Kristina Shea,et al.  Automated Mapping of Physical Effects to Functions Using Abstraction Ports Based on Bond Graphs , 2013 .

[27]  P. K. Kannan,et al.  Design of Robust New Products Under Variability: Marketing Meets Design , 2005 .

[28]  Xiaoping Du,et al.  Efficient Uncertainty Analysis Methods for Multidisciplinary Robust Design , 2002 .

[29]  Farrokh Mistree,et al.  A procedure for robust design: Minimizing variations caused by noise factors and control factors , 1996 .

[30]  Matthew I. Campbell,et al.  An experimental study on the effects of a computational design tool on concept generation , 2009 .

[31]  Tom Fleischer Handbook Of Optimization In Complex Networks Theory And Applications , 2016 .

[32]  Rainer Leupers,et al.  Multiprocessor Systems on Chip , 2011 .

[33]  Wei Chen,et al.  Methodology for Managing the Effect of Uncertainty in Simulation-Based Design , 2000 .

[34]  Jian S. Dai,et al.  Geometric Constraint and Mobility Variation of Two 3SvPSv Metamorphic Parallel Mechanisms , 2013 .

[35]  Kristina Shea,et al.  Computational Synthesis of Product Architectures Based on Object-Oriented Graph Grammars , 2012 .

[36]  J. Renaud,et al.  Improved coordination in non-hierarchic system optimization , 1992 .

[37]  Jay Patel,et al.  An Approach to Automate and Optimize Concept Generation of Sheet Metal Parts by Topological and Parametric Decoupling , 2010 .

[38]  Brett Malone,et al.  Flexible Approximation Model Approach for Bi -Level Integrated System Synthesis , 2004 .

[39]  坂和 正敏 Fuzzy sets and interactive multiobjective optimization , 1993 .

[40]  Jianxin Jiao,et al.  Modelling platform-based product configuration using programmed attributed graph grammars , 2003 .

[41]  Matthias Nussbaum Concurrent Design Of Products Manufacturing Processes And Systems , 2016 .

[42]  Hong-Zhong Huang,et al.  A Hierarchical Statistical Sensitivity Analysis Method for Multilevel Systems With Shared , 2010 .

[43]  田口 玄一,et al.  Taguchi on robust technology development : bringing quality engineering upstream , 1993 .

[44]  Matthew I. Campbell,et al.  Automating the conceptual design process: “From black box to component selection” , 2010, Artificial Intelligence for Engineering Design, Analysis and Manufacturing.

[45]  Matthew I. Campbell,et al.  Automated synthesis of electromechanical design configurations from empirical analysis of function to form mapping , 2009 .

[46]  Kroo Ilan,et al.  Multidisciplinary Optimization Methods for Aircraft Preliminary Design , 1994 .

[47]  Dimitri N. Mavris,et al.  Uncertainty Modeling and Management in Multidisciplinary Analysis and Synthesis , 2000 .

[48]  Xiaoping Du,et al.  Study on Uncertainty Analysis and Robust Design: A Review , 2006 .

[49]  Deyi Xue,et al.  Modeling of Evolutionary Design Database , 2006, J. Comput. Inf. Sci. Eng..

[50]  Erik K. Antonsson,et al.  Tuning parameters in engineering design , 1993 .

[51]  Hector A. Jensen,et al.  Use of approximation concepts in fuzzy design problems , 2000 .

[52]  Vipin Kumar,et al.  A hybrid methodology for enhancing reliability of large systems in conceptual design and its application to the design of a multiphase flow station , 2005 .

[53]  Genichi Taguchi,et al.  Taguchi's Quality Engineering Handbook , 2004 .

[54]  Grzegorz Rozenberg,et al.  Handbook of Graph Grammars and Computing by Graph Transformations, Volume 1: Foundations , 1997 .

[55]  Christina Bloebaum,et al.  Robust Multi-Objective Genetic Algorithm Concurrent Subspace Optimization (R-MOGACSSO) for Multidisciplinary Design , 2006 .

[56]  Wei Chen,et al.  A CONCEPT EXPLORATION METHOD FOR DETERMINING ROBUST TOP-LEVEL SPECIFICATIONS , 1996 .

[57]  Jaroslaw Sobieszczanski-Sobieski,et al.  Bilevel Integrated System Synthesis with Response Surfaces , 2000 .

[58]  Nam P. Suh,et al.  Axiomatic Design Theory for Systems , 1998 .

[59]  Hartmut Ehrig,et al.  Handbook of graph grammars and computing by graph transformation: vol. 3: concurrency, parallelism, and distribution , 1999 .

[60]  Jaroslaw Sobieszczanski-Sobieski,et al.  Optimization by decomposition: A step from hierarchic to non-hierarchic systems , 1989 .

[61]  Roger Jianxin Jiao,et al.  Graph Grammar Based Product Family Modeling , 2002, Concurr. Eng. Res. Appl..

[62]  Hong-Zhong Huang,et al.  Possibility-Based Multidisciplinary Design Optimization in the Framework of Sequential Optimization and Reliability Assessment , 2009 .

[63]  John R. Dixon,et al.  Guiding conceptual design through behavioral reasoning , 1994 .